Sweet Tox Building Update

As many of you Sweets know, we bought a new building! It’s located in Menomonee Falls, and boy oh BOY are we excited to share it with you all!


Flashback to 2017 when Katie first opened her doors in a little room in the back of a salon, and began seeing our wonderful patients and perfecting her craft. Once she outgrew that, she transitioned into the New Berlin building we all know and love! The space contained only two injecting rooms and a tiny waiting room to house Katie, Dani and Ashley! Since our patient population began to grow and Katie knew she’d want to bring on more nurses, she busted into the space right next door and created our special self-love oasis that has brought so much confidence and happiness to many. Well, a couple of years later, we outgrew this beautiful space here that has shaped us into the business we are today.

After a lengthy search of the PERFECT space for the continued growth of Sweet Tox, Katie finally stumbled upon our soon-to-be beauty and fell in love with it. With its beautiful pillars and sturdy bones, she knew it was the right fit for all of us. Although a lot of work had to be done to make the space our own, it’s come along better than we could have ever hoped.

Contractors and vendors have been working around the clock to create the most innovative, patient-centered experience for all Sweet Tox stans (because you deserve it). Including a training room, IV lounge, bigger patient rooms and reception area, our very own Cafe and SO much more, the new Sweet Tox HQ will blow your socks off!
